The year 2009 was a quiet one for Orlando in regards to the hurricane season which started on June 1 and ended on Nov 30.   There was record-breaking rain fall that flooded Volusia County in the month of May.  The rainfall in the Orlando area helped make up for the 31 percent shortfall of precipitation for the year.  There was a total of 10 named storms in 2009 and only two of them, Bill and Fred, were actual hurricanes.  Hopefully the year 2010  hurricane season will be just as quiet as last year.
